Wagering Requirements: The Math You Never Saw Coming

Imagine a bonus of ₹8,000 with a 40x wagering condition. That’s ₹320,000 in required turnover. If your slot’s RTP is 96%, you need to lose roughly ₹300,000 before you stand a chance to cash out. Compare that to a 20x condition on a ₹5,000 bonus, which still forces ₹100,000 in turnover—still a massive gap.

Hidden Clauses That Drain Your Wallet

The Terms & Conditions often include a maximum cash‑out cap of 2× the bonus. A ₹12,000 bonus therefore caps winnings at ₹24,000. If you manage a lucky streak that would otherwise push you to ₹40,000, the casino clamps it down, leaving you with a 40% shortfall.

Yet the fine print also stipulates that any win from the bonus must be wagered on “selected games only.” If you prefer high‑payout slots like Mega Moolah, the bonus excludes you, forcing you onto lower‑return games where the house edge climbs to 3% from the usual 2%.
